I'm building a new gaming PC featuring the 9070 XT graphics card, and I'm aiming for a solid gaming experience primarily at 2K resolution. I enjoy playing FPS games, survival crafting titles, and even some World of Warcraft. In my search for the best CPU options, I've noticed that the 9800X3D, 7800X3D, and 7600X3D are often recommended. However, I rarely see the 7600X3D mentioned in discussions. I'm considering a good Microcenter bundle that includes this CPU, but I'm curious about the community's thoughts on whether it's a good fit. Ultimately, I want to ensure that the CPU I pick won't bottleneck the GPU in the games I play. Thanks in advance for your insights!

The 7600X3D should work well for your setup. It's not widely mentioned because it's a Microcenter exclusive, so only those near a store are likely to buy it.

At 2K resolution, you’re likely looking at negligible differences between the 9800X3D and 7800X3D, or even the 7600X3D. If you want thorough insight, check out Steve's video on Gamer's Nexus, which dives deep into the 7600X3D's performance. Remember, at that resolution, the GPU will typically be the limiting factor, not the CPU, though a better CPU will give you a slight performance boost.
